Plautus, Titus Maccius (c. 254-184 BC).

Description

  • Ex Plauti comediis xx quarum carmina magna ex parte in mensum suum restituta sunt. (Venice): Aldus, (July 1522)
4to (208 x 131mm.), ff. [14], 284, illustration: woodcut printer's device on title-page and final recto, binding: near-contemporary vellum, gilt centrepiece on both covers, binding slightly soiled, lacking two pairs of ties

Literature

Censimento 16 CNCE 37687; Renouard p. 94; Texas 190; UCLA 211
